Cual es el programa que pertenece a las Naciones Unidas que promueve los objetivos de desarrollo sostenible

Answer:

Los 17 objetivos de las organizaciones de Naciones Unidas.

Explanation:

Las 17 metas de las naciones unidas es un programa desarrollado en Río de Janeiro en 2012 que comprende una serie de metas y objetivos orientados al desarrollo sostenible, la protección del medio ambiente y la mejor calidad de vida de la población mundial. Este programa comprende los mayores desafíos políticos y económicos que se enfrentan actualmente de manera medible y busca desarrollar soluciones a problemas que afectan a muchas personas en todo el mundo, como la pobreza, el hambre, las enfermedades, etc. Hay otros objetivos también incluidos en el programa, como los cambios climáticos que enfrenta el mundo que provocan el efecto invernadero, el consumo sostenible para frenar el capitalismo desenfrenado y los impactos ambientales que provocan la degradación ambiental.

While an observer on Earth sees a total solar eclipse, an astronaut is on the near side of the Moon. What would the astronaut se
fredd [130]

Answer:

The astronaut on the near side of the moon would see the Earth's day side with a dark spot moving across it

Explanation:

A total solar eclipse occurs when the moon comes between the sun and the Earth and casts a shadow over the Earth. When an astronaut is on the near side of the moon, he would see the Earth just fine but with a dark spot (the moon's shadow) moving across the Earth.

Why are peaks of rocky otains higher then applacia moutains.?
likoan [24]
The Appalachian Mountains are older than the Rocky Mountains and therefore have had more time to weather and get worn down.  The Rocky Mountains are still considered to be relatively young and haven't weathered as much.
